
When pirated version of multicrore Malayalam movie 'Pulimurugan' started doing rounds on the internet it came as a big jolt to the makers of the film and movie buffs. Now, it is reported that the movie was leaked from a multiplex.
The forensic examination of the prints revealed that the 100-crore club movie was allegedly leaked from Kochi-based 'Cinepolis'.
In the wake of fresh development, the Kerala Film Distributors Association has decided to blacklist Cinepolis.
A few days back, following a complaint from Tomichan Mulakupadam, the producer of multi-crore movie 'Pulimurugan' the anti-piracy cell of Kerala police department had a launched a massive crackdown against piracy gangs.
During the probe, five people were detained from Malappuram and Palakkad districts. Investigators had also arrested three men from 'Tamilrockers', a gang having links with international piracy racket.
